Transaction 65e1521814bb3d39b501df5e839f39dae756c9f5c512caf23503979ed1de25c1
1 Input
1 Output
-
65e1521814bb3d39b501df5e839f39dae756c9f5c512caf23503979ed1de25c1:0
- value
- 150000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1afb452b3b8f4796e01e141a7b124ad265e88b53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13TfaYhWiiBz5khcffnKxwvzsi4TeWqWza